How Embedded Software Enhances Smart Home Systems

Embedded software is the backbone of smart home systems, transforming ordinary devices into intelligent, interconnected solutions that enhance our daily lives.

In today’s fast-paced world, smart home systems have become a cornerstone of modern living. They promise convenience, efficiency, and a touch of futuristic magic. But what powers these smart systems? The answer lies in embedded software. This hidden gem is the unsung hero of the smart home revolution, seamlessly integrating hardware and software to create the seamless experiences we’ve come to expect. Let’s dive into how embedded software enhances smart home systems and why it’s so crucial for their success.

The Role of Embedded Software in Smart Homes

Embedded software, essentially a specialized type of software programmed into hardware devices, is critical for smart home systems. It provides the intelligence that allows devices to perform specific tasks and communicate with each other. Without it, your smart thermostat, security cameras, and voice assistants would be nothing more than regular gadgets.

**1. ** Seamless Integration and Automation

One of the standout features of smart home systems is automation. Imagine your lights dimming automatically as you start your favorite movie or your thermostat adjusting to the perfect temperature as you arrive home. Embedded software makes these scenarios possible by enabling devices to communicate with one another and perform tasks based on pre-set conditions.

**2. ** Enhanced Device Control

Embedded software also provides a user-friendly interface for controlling smart devices. Through mobile apps or voice commands, users can manage their home systems from virtually anywhere. This control is made possible by the software embedded within each device, which processes commands and executes actions in real-time.

**3. ** Energy Efficiency and Cost Savings

Energy efficiency is another significant advantage of smart home systems. Embedded software allows for advanced energy management features, such as scheduling and remote control of appliances. For example, your smart thermostat can learn your preferences and adjust heating and cooling schedules to optimize energy use. This not only reduces your carbon footprint but also saves money on utility bills.

**4. ** Enhanced Security and Safety

Safety is paramount in any smart home. Embedded software plays a crucial role in this aspect by enabling sophisticated security features. Smart cameras, motion sensors, and alarms are all powered by embedded software that processes data, detects anomalies, and sends alerts in real-time. This ensures that homeowners are always aware of potential security threats, even when they’re not at home.

Challenges and Considerations

While embedded software brings numerous benefits to smart home systems, it’s not without its challenges.

**1. ** Security Concerns

As smart home systems become more interconnected, they also become more vulnerable to cyber-attacks. Embedded software must be designed with robust security measures to protect against potential breaches. Regular updates and patches are essential to maintain the integrity of the system.

**2. ** Compatibility Issues

With a wide range of smart home devices on the market, compatibility can sometimes be a concern. Embedded software must be versatile enough to work seamlessly with different devices and platforms. Standardization and open protocols can help mitigate compatibility issues and ensure smooth integration.

**3. ** Complexity of Development

Developing embedded software for smart home systems requires specialized knowledge and expertise. It involves understanding both hardware and software intricacies to create efficient and reliable solutions. Companies often invest in dedicated teams to handle the development and maintenance of this software.

The Future of Embedded Software in Smart Homes

The future of embedded software in smart home systems looks promising. As technology continues to advance, we can expect even more sophisticated features and capabilities. Here’s a glimpse of what’s on the horizon:

**1. ** AI and Machine Learning Integration

Artificial Intelligence (AI) and machine learning are poised to revolutionize smart home systems. Embedded software will increasingly incorporate these technologies to enhance automation, personalize user experiences, and predict user needs based on behavioral patterns.

**2. ** Greater Interoperability

The push for greater interoperability among smart home devices will drive the development of more standardized protocols and frameworks. This will ensure that devices from different manufacturers can work together seamlessly, providing a more cohesive user experience.

**3. ** Enhanced Energy Management

Future advancements in embedded software will further improve energy management capabilities. Expect to see more intelligent systems that optimize energy use in real-time, integrate renewable energy sources, and provide detailed insights into energy consumption patterns.

Conclusion

Embedded software is the backbone of smart home systems, transforming ordinary devices into intelligent, interconnected solutions that enhance our daily lives. From seamless automation and energy efficiency to advanced security features, this software plays a pivotal role in making smart homes more functional and user-friendly.

As technology continues to evolve, the role of embedded software will only become more significant. With ongoing advancements in AI, interoperability, and energy management, the future of smart home systems promises even greater convenience and efficiency. For homeowners and tech enthusiasts alike, the continued evolution of embedded software is an exciting development to watch.

So next time you adjust your smart thermostat or receive an alert from your security system, remember the embedded software working tirelessly behind the scenes to make it all possible.

To know More About Embedded software

 


Niti Emily

20 Blog posts

Comments